Slab Leaks occur when water lines underneath a concrete slab foundation burst from too much pressure, shifting, or aging. These sort of leaks can take place in both hot and cold water lines. They can be tiny holes or large blow out leaks.
Water pressure is the primary cause of slab leaks. Expansion and contraction from changing temperatures can cause plumbing pipes to rub against the slab and in time cause the development of leaks. There are a variety of different clues that will alert you that there might be a slab leak. Common signs can vary depending how extensive the leak is. Warm areas on floors in any room could indicate a hot water leak. A unusual rise in your water bill might be another indication. You may also become aware of mold or mildew, particularly in surfaces with carpeting. Mold could develop prior to other signs of a leak. One more clue is running water sounds.
Leak detecting needs to be done very carefully. Our expert plumbers primarily use electronic detection and other methods to find the specific place of the leak.
After a leak in the slab has been pinpointed, the service technician will recommend the best approach for repair. They could recommend cutting a portion of the slab to do the repair, re-routing the leaking pipe, or repiping. In some situations making a direct repair through the slab is not an option.
In many circumstances a slab repair is covered by the homeowners insurance policy. Your plumbing professional can provide an estimate to help you with submitting an insurance claim.
